The Band Perry are combining two of their favorite things -- music and fashion -- into one stylish night, and it's all for a worthwhile cause.

The sibling trio, made up of Kimberly, Neil and Reid Perry, will headline the 2014 Symphony Fashion Show, held at Nashville's Schermerhorn Symphony Center. Proceeds from the event benefit the Nashville Symphony’s education and community engagement programs, which serve 100,000 children and adults across Middle Tennessee each year.

This year's event will include former 'Project Runway' winner Christian Siriano's Fall 2014 collection. The evening will also feature a red carpet and silent auction, as well as a tented dining experience following the exclusive fashion show.

“Music and fashion have always gone hand in hand, and as a band, fashion is an important part of our performances,” the trio explain. “We are excited to be part of the 2014 Symphony Fashion Show and can’t wait to see Christian Siriano’s collection.”
